void red() {
digitalWrite(7, 1);
digitalWrite(6, 0);
digitalWrite(5, 0);
}
void green() {
digitalWrite(7, 0);
digitalWrite(6, 1);
digitalWrite(5, 0);
}
void blue() {
digitalWrite(7, 0);
digitalWrite(6, 0);
digitalWrite(5, 1);
}
void off() {
digitalWrite(7, 0);
digitalWrite(6, 0);
digitalWrite(5, 0);
}
void setup() {
// put your setup code here, to run once:
Serial.begin(9600);
pinMode(7, OUTPUT);
pinMode(6, OUTPUT);
pinMode(5, OUTPUT);
}
void loop() {
// put your main code here, to run repeatedly:
if (Serial.available())
{ Serial.println(analogRead(A1));
}
int rgb = map(analogRead(A1), 0, 1023, 1, 3);
if (rgb == 1)
{
red();
}
if (rgb == 2)
{
green();
}
if (rgb == 3)
{
blue();
}
}
첫댓글 외계어네요! 외계어를 알아듣는 색깔들. 나보다 낫다~
외계어 = c언어